概括
一个新的剂量测量协议,JSMP Linac标准剂量测量24简化了医疗线性加速器的吸收剂量计算. 与较旧的标准剂量计12相比,这种更新的指南显著降低了剂量递送的不确定性.

背景情况:
- 目前的剂量测量协议,如标准剂量测量12,依赖于60Co玛辐射以获得参考质量.
- 医学线性加速器在放射治疗中被广泛使用,因此需要准确的剂量测量协议.

The average temperature of Earth is the subject of much current discussion. Earth is in radiative contact with both the Sun and dark space; it receives almost all its energy from the radiation of the Sun and reflects some of it into outer space. Dark space is very cold, about 3 K, so Earth radiates energy into it. For instance, heat transfer occurs from soil and grasses, the rate of which can be so rapid that frost can occur on clear summer evenings, even in warm latitudes.

Nomograms and tabulations are vital tools used by clinicians to design accurate and individualized dosage regimens. These instruments provide a straightforward method for adjusting dosages based on individual patient characteristics, including age, weight, and physiological condition. The foundation of a drug's nomogram is population pharmacokinetic data collected and analyzed using specific models. Positron emission tomography (PET) is a medical imaging technique involving radiopharmaceuticals — substances that emit short-lived radiation. Although the first PET scanner was introduced in 1961, it took 15 more years before radiopharmaceuticals were combined with the technique and revolutionized its potential.
